Allison Bryan is a scholar working on Geochemistry and Petrology, Paleontology and Atmospheric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Allison Bryan has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 310 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Geochemistry and Petrology, 3 papers in Paleontology and 3 papers in Atmospheric Science. Recurrent topics in Allison Bryan’s work include Geochemistry and Elemental Analysis (5 papers), Geology and Paleoclimatology Research (3 papers) and Paleontology and Stratigraphy of Fossils (3 papers). Allison Bryan is often cited by papers focused on Geochemistry and Elemental Analysis (5 papers), Geology and Paleoclimatology Research (3 papers) and Paleontology and Stratigraphy of Fossils (3 papers). Allison Bryan coll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Russia. Allison Bryan's co-authors include Laura E. Wasylenki, Shuofei Dong, Elise B. Wilkes, Yu‐Te Hsieh, William B. Homoky, Gideon M. Henderson, D. Porcelli, Luke Bridgestock, Alexander J. Dickson and Jeffrey A. Snyder and has published in prestigious journals such as Geochimica et Cosmochimica Acta, Earth and Planetary Science Letters and Chemical Geology.
